Why is Available plus Used greater than my total disk space?

My MacBook Pro has a 1 TB SSD represented by "Macintosh HD". I had approx. 220 GB in my Trash and approx. 235 GB Available in Finder's Get Info, which made sense because I had more than 500 GB of data.


I emptied my Trash. Finder's Get Info is now showing 464.7 GB Available and 796.9 GB of Used. When combined, this is greater than 1 TB, which does not make sense. I don't know why Used didn't go down to approx. 540 GB. Why is it at 796.9 GB?


On Disk Utility, "Container disk1" is showing 15.75 GB for "Macintosh HD" and 781.17 GB for "Macintosh HD - Data".


I had restarted my Mac and it is still showing the same numbers.


My Mac is running Monterrey 12.2.1

Every time I delete a large chuck of data, "Purgeable" space increases by that same deleted amount. That space IS available for use and Mac will release it to "normal" empty space sooner or later. This may be what you're seeing.


I use the paid version of DaisyDisk to force the release of Purgeable space. I got it for another reason but it works very well to do this.
